For Christianity, the central festival of the faith is Easter, on which Christians celebrate their belief that Jesus Christ rose from the dead on the day after his crucifixion.
In Islam, the main days of commemoration centre around Ramadan, the period of fasting, and Eid, of which there are two in the year.
In Hinduism, the word for festivals is ‘Utsava’, which translates to ‘cause to grow upward’.
Hindus observe sacred occasions through festive observances, while many of their holidays are seasonal.
Some Hindus celebrate the harvest, while others commemorate the birth of Gods or heroes.
